Transaction ed7815c89559343a7946182b24031849c6789ae3d929baa81df3819315016864
1 Input
1 Output
-
ed7815c89559343a7946182b24031849c6789ae3d929baa81df3819315016864:0
- value
- 86634
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 2fd2d5b99e22cdce0f5fe195ef2664e7600445f0 OP_EQUALVERIFY OP_CHECKSIG
- address
- 15MsL5bJy5BNEUKcdRL331YbcUMsxxPcLp